After the tragic death of her mother, Jessica is forced to take control of her life and care for her troubled brother, Liam. The burden of responsibilities becomes even heavier when Liam disappears, seemingly heading to his old home, the one he shared with their mother, a 15-hour journey away.

The last person to see Liam is Steven, the owner of the local grocery store, Ahori's Shop Shop; an ex (annoying and highly competitive) classmate of Jessica. Steven unexpectedly shows interest in helping her, and feelings quickly surface; they share much more than they realize.

With Steven's assistance, Jessica embarks on a journey with a single goal: to bring Liam home safe and sound. Throughout the trip, both confront a grief they never allowed themselves to face and immerse themselves in an unexpected romance.

'The Love Receipt' is an emotional tale where secrets are unveiled, wounds are exposed, and love blossoms amid miles of travel, proving that sometimes, the quest for answers leads us to find what we need most.
